Raymond George Pollman, 92, of Humboldt died Sunday, June 20, 2010, at Heritage Health Care Center in Chanute.
He was born Dec. 13, 1917, in Butler County near Leon, to Charles and Susie (Singleton) Pollman. He grew up on a farm in Woodson County.
On Jan. 27, 1943, he married Frances Marie Kinney in St. Peter’s Lutheran Church’s parsonage in Humboldt. They made their home in Humboldt where he worked as a heavy equipment operator for Monarch Cement Company for 39 years, retiring in 1983. She died Nov. 20, 2009.
He enjoyed hunting, fishing, gardening, woodworking and playing cards. He was a member of St. Peter’s Lutheran Church in Humboldt and the men’s organization in the church.
He is survived by a son, Jerry and his wife, Theresa, Sand Springs, Okla., and a daughter, Margaret Charlene (Peggy) North and her husband, Charles, Darlington, Wis.; a brother, Hugh, Humboldt; four grandchildren, Stephanie Lange and her husband John, Deborah Weaver and her husband Dan, Scott Pollman and his wife Liesel, and Neal Pollman and Lucy Choisnard; four great-grandchildren; and a number of nieces and nephews.
Four brothers, Merl, Marvin, James and Carl, died earlier.
